<p></p><p>Quinta do Vallado, established in 1716, is one of the oldest and most famous Quintas in the Douro Valley. It once belonged to the legendary Dona Antia Adelaide Ferreira, and still belongs to her descendents.</p>
<p></p><p>Monte Velho was launched for the first time in 1992, its name comes from the monte located next to the Caridade reservoir, at Herdade do Espor. At the time, the wine boasted the same origin and philosophy as Espor Reserva but was created to reach more people and make daily wine consumption an experience.</p>

<p></p><p>For more than three centuries, the Paço do Conde Estate has been owned by the Castelo Branco family. The origin of one of the oldest agricultural enterprises in the country, founded in 1928 under the name Sociedade Agrícola Paço do Conde, is now managed by the current owners, José António Ferrão Castelo Branco, Luís Miguel Ferrão Castelo Branco and Maria Luísa Castelo Branco Schmidt, grandchildren of the founder.</p>
<p></p><p>Niepoort Nat Cool Baga is naturally “cool and funky”. It represents an innovative concept initiated by Niepoort, in which various producers came together to create light and easy-to-drink wines. Nat Cool try to showcase a different and elegant side of the Baga grape variety</p>

<p></p><p>Copo Alegre Vinhas Velhas Red Wine has a concentrated colour. On the nose it's a serious wine, combining floral notes, red fruits, spices and nuts, revealing the complexity of the old vines that gave rise to it. On the palate it is structured, fresh and with excellent acidity. It also reveals its youth through the nerve of its tannins</p>
<p> The 2011 Torre Do Esporao, mostly Alicante Bouschet, Syrah and Touriga Franca along with some others, has been in bottle for some two years now. This is sensual in its texture, caressing and appealing. Yet, it has plenty of power and backbone. Intense on the finish, it is not yet able to express its fine fruit. Yet, in the long run, it seems sophisticated, balanced and very classy. It should age beautifully, too.</p> <p></p>
